public class RenameRefactoringController extends Object
| Constructor and Description |
|---|
RenameRefactoringController() |
| Modifier and Type | Method and Description |
|---|---|
void |
cancelLinkedMode()
Linked mode is unrecoverable canceled.
|
protected IRenameSupport |
createRenameSupport(IRenameElementContext context,
String name) |
RenameLinkedMode |
getActiveLinkedMode() |
protected String |
getOriginalName(XtextEditor xtextEditor) |
protected XtextEditor |
getXtextEditor() |
void |
initialize(IRenameElementContext renameElementContext) |
protected void |
restoreOriginalSelection() |
protected void |
startDirectRefactoring() |
protected void |
startLinkedEditing() |
void |
startRefactoring(IRenameElementContext renameElementContext) |
void |
startRefactoring(RefactoringType refactoringType) |
protected void |
startRefactoringWithDialog(boolean previewOnly) |
public void initialize(IRenameElementContext renameElementContext)
public void startRefactoring(IRenameElementContext renameElementContext)
public void startRefactoring(RefactoringType refactoringType)
protected void startLinkedEditing()
throws InterruptedException
InterruptedExceptionpublic RenameLinkedMode getActiveLinkedMode()
public void cancelLinkedMode()
protected void startDirectRefactoring()
throws InterruptedException
InterruptedExceptionprotected void startRefactoringWithDialog(boolean previewOnly)
throws InterruptedException
InterruptedExceptionprotected String getOriginalName(XtextEditor xtextEditor)
protected IRenameSupport createRenameSupport(IRenameElementContext context, String name)
protected void restoreOriginalSelection()
protected XtextEditor getXtextEditor()
Copyright © 2016. All Rights Reserved.